A key aspect is choosing the right development methodology. This involves considering factors like project size, target audience, budget constraints, and desired capabilities. Popular options include native development for iOS and Android, cross-platform frameworks like React Native or Flutter, and web-based app development using technologies like JavaScript and HTML5.
Each path presents its own set of pros and limitations. For instance, native apps often offer the best speed, but can be more time-consuming and costly to develop. Cross-platform frameworks provide code portability across multiple platforms, while web apps are highly accessible and require less upfront development effort.
